Javier “Chicarito” Hernandez has had a long career in Europe as he has played in different teams such as Real Madrid, Bayer Leverkusen, West Ham United and Sevilla Now, however, the Azteca striker has spoken out and explained that he would return to Manchester United, a group in which he also had shootings.
Let’s remember that right now premier league team, under the command of Eric Ten Hag did not have a good start in the competition, moreover, the same looking for attacker Well, one of his figures like Cristiano Ronaldo will be looking for a new team away from Old Trafford.
For his part, the now Mexican striker stressed that if he returns to the European team, even though he made it clearand with great respect for the institution Where is he playing now? Los Angeles Galaxy of Major League Soccer in the USA.
“If United had come and asked me, I would have definitely told them ‘Yes, I will play for free’, of course I would have done that. But I also want to be very respectful of my club. I play all the time and I think I’m sure I’ll win the title with LA Galaxy. In the future, if something happens, it will happen, but in my opinion, I am 100 percent committed to Los Angeles.
